Output 8c32f96ecbdd44ea802caad2821f63ca2dd36faf24b8e87bb166bcf507a35fba:1

value
49639
script pubkey
OP_0 OP_PUSHBYTES_20 3c70630628e65c1a34db00b99e823afdce4bd862
address
bc1q83cxxp3guewp5dxmqzueaq36lh8yhkrzu0hv7w
transaction
8c32f96ecbdd44ea802caad2821f63ca2dd36faf24b8e87bb166bcf507a35fba
confirmations
2036
spent
true